Isla de Cattáneo
Isla de Cattáneo is an island in Entre Rios, Mesopotamia. Isla de Cattáneo is situated nearby to the quarter Super Usina, as well as near the neighborhood Villa Los Pescadores.| Tap on a place to explore it |
